Orysa Fabric (Spun-Like Filament Fabric)Orysa fabric (commercially known in Chinese textile clusters as "Aolisha") is a highly cost-effective, engineered synthetic textile designed to replicate the soft tactile profile of short-staple natural yarns using 100% continuous filament polyester. Woven primarily using standard plain-weave structures on advanced water-jet looms, Orysa utilizes looped, texturized Draw Texturized Yarn (DTY) or Fully Drawn Yarn (FDY) setups to build microscopic surface crimps and loops. This specialized filament arrangement eliminates the cheap plastic glare typical of standard raw polyester, generating a natural, spun-like "hairy" matte texturing. Typically configured from a split-filament synthetic matrix of Polyester (PET) and Polyamide (Nylon), these wipers utilize an advanced "orange-petal" cross-section (桔瓣式技术). This structural geometry expands the fabric’s surface area, creating sharp wedge-like boundaries that lift micro-contamination rather than pushing it around. Unlike standard piece-dyed Oxford cloth-where greige fabric is woven from raw yarn and then immersion-dyed in bulk batches-yarn-dyed production dyes individual filaments prior to loom setup. This deep integration allows dye molecules to fully saturate the core of the yarn, yielding premium color depth, clear patterns, and a 42% reduction in surface pilling. While its specialized manufacturing process increases initial costs by approximately 1.5 times compared to piece-dyed alternatives, its lifespan is extended by over 30%. Originally engineered to replicate luxurious organic silk taffeta, modern industrial-grade polyester taffeta features high tensile strength, exceptional dimensional stability, low shrinkage (under 5%), and remarkable crispness. Representing over 65% of the industrial base fabric market and 30% of outerwear insulation liners, this textile serves as a high-efficiency carrier for technical coatings like polyurethane (PU), polyacrylate (PA), silvering, and flame retardants.
